Spotlight on Anima Singers at Lyric Opera, Mag Mile
Some of Glen Ellyn's Anima Singers can be seen performing at the Civic Opera House, and others will usher in the Christmas season Nov. 20 during the annual parade on Chicago's Michigan Avenue.
When the curtain rises at the Lyric Opera of Chicago this month for "A Midsummer Night's Dream," the focal point rests not on a strapping tenor or a dominant alto but on a forest of singing fairies. One of those fairies, Anna Stephan, 13, of Glen Ellyn, said that when she looks out on the sea of people at the theater, which seats more than 3,500, "I'm just like, 'Is this a dream? Is this really happening?'" Anna and the group of two dozen fairies, ages 9 to 13, have flitted into the spotlight, literally, because they're members of the Glen Ellyn-based Anima: Young Singers of Greater Chicago, formerly known as the Glen Ellyn Children's Chorus.
